Centre for Systematic Review (CSR)

 

faith Bangladesh is committed to evidence synthesis, assembling and analyzing data from multiple research studies to generate sound evidence and policy relevant research. Our systematic reviews use objective and transparent methods to identify, evaluate and summarize the best available research evidence to help make informed decisions about health and social care. Through the dissemination of high quality systematic reviews and meta-analyses, we promote the use of research evidence in decision-making for health. Our reviews cover a wide range of health care topics including non-communicable diseases and mental health, using objective, systematic, transparent and replicable methods.

 

Our review team that manages and conducts the review have a range of skills including the expertise in systematic review methods, information retrieval, the relevant topic area, statistics, health economics and/or qualitative research methods where appropriate. In addition to the team who undertake the review there is a number of individuals (advisory group) who are consulted at various stages, including health care professionals, patient representatives, service users and experts in research methods. They provide comment on the protocol and final report and provide input to ensure that the review has practical relevance to likely end users.

 

faith Bangladesh holds national and regional capacity-building workshops to develop individual and institutional capacities in conducting different types of research evidence syntheses. We conduct priority setting exercises with multi-disciplinary stakeholders and researchers to prioritize review topics on health policy and health systems research. faith Bangladesh prepares summaries and holds deliberative dialogues to promote the uptake of evidence from systematic reviews and rapid reviews on prioritized topics into policies.
